Where to start? From the beginning I guess, the initial ordering process was easy enough, DIY kitche

Where to start?
From the beginning I guess, the initial ordering process was easy enough, DIY kitchens checked the plan and made suggestions to amend the order to include items i missed, at that point I was very happy.
Had a delivery week which i was a little worried about because I was not given a day in that week when the kitchen would be delivered, I would be contacted nearer the agreed week and would be given a 3 day delivery window which was not ideal, I was given the 3 day delivery window so took 3 days off work, I was told the kitchen would arrive "Thursday to Saturday of the delivery week, between 8am and 10pm and the driver would call 1 hour prior", so for 3 days I waited and finally on the Saturday I had a call at 8pm telling me they would arrive at 10pm, they arrived at 10.30pm !!!!!
So my neighbours had to endure a very large lorry making lots of noise outside our house for 90 mins whilst the kitchen was unloaded, not very happy about that.
FROM THEN ON THE WHOLE DIY KITCHEN EXPERIENCE HAS BEEN THE WORST EXPERIENCE FROM ANY RETAILER I HAVE EVER HAD.

The 1st delivery of the kitchen at 10.30pm was on Saturday 17th January, today is Friday 20th February and I still have not got a complete kitchen.

I am currently on my 11th delivery.

1) kitchen arrives and I find damaged units and doors (you can't phone anyone you have to fill in an online form)
2) 2 weeks later some of the damaged doors are delivered, some of those are damaged too !!, another online form filled in
3) a couple of days later some more doors arrive, no holes for hinges - another online for filled in
4) legs missing, some replacements delivered
5) more doors arrive, damaged again, another form filled in
6) replacement units arrive, door damaged and door missing, drawers missing - another online form filled in
7) drawer fronts arrive, damaged and no holes drilled for fitment....
8) drawers arrive again, items missing
9) missing items arrive, still missing items
10) missing items arrive but still not complete
11) awaiting final missing items

I have complained multiple times via email and just get the standard "we apologise for any inconvenience caused"

So 11 deliveries and at this point I still have not got a complete kitchen, if you decide to use DIY kitchens you may well have a kitchen delivered and all is good BUT if you get any damage then good luck with getting it resolved quickly.
Luckily for me I fitted the kitchen myself but if you have a kitchen fitter then find one who has a lot of patience and isn't too busy with other clients.
DiY kitchens must think that I don't have a life and that I can just stay at home all day every day awaiting a delivery that comes between 8am and 10pm.

Some of the damaged items have clearly been packed damaged because the packaging was in perfect condition but the contents were damaged.

Think very carefully if ordering from this company because if you do get any issues then you will need to ensure someone is able to be at their delivery beck and call as you cannot choose a delivery day, or a time, you are given a day and that's that, if no one is home then that's tough.

THE WORST RETAILER EXPERIENCE I HAVE EVER HAD.

PS.....when you do fill in the online form or email them, they do not respond for 24 hours and sometimes when they respond they just respond with a question which if they read the email they would not need to ask that question, I asked for someone to call me but had a response basically saying they dont do that and I should email.
I currently have sent over 40 emails !!!!

My advice to anyone thinking of using DIY kitchens is to take their quote and see if Wren or Howdens will match it, especially if you have a Wren or Howdens local to you, we had Howdens match the DIY quote but opted for DIY, clearly a mistake in hindsight.

As a general builder I've fitted kitchens from all the main suppliers in the UK and DIY Kitchens are

As a general builder I've fitted kitchens from all the main suppliers in the UK and DIY Kitchens are definitely my preferred choice.

The quality of everything is really good, far superior than many other brands, and they're also cheaper than the competition too.

On occasions I have found damaged items but these things happen in transit and can't be helped. The customer support is really helpful though and it's simple to organise replacements through the website.

All in all I highly recommend them.
